使用Access和SharePoint的最佳方法是什么?

时间:2015-12-22 23:26:48

标签: excel vba ms-access sharepoint sharepoint-2010

我是目前与国防部合作的承包商。我主要与VBA和Microsoft Office(2013)合作生产"桌面工具"因为这是这里文化的范围。很少有客户从连接所有数据的完全集成系统访问他们的产品。其中一个原因是许多不同的系统需要用户名和密码才能获取和收集数据。因此,MS Access,Excel和PowerPoint等办公产品是他们报告和仪表板的核心和土豆。只使用VBA的职业生涯还有第二次生命,我认为这已经很久了。我的工具使用SharePoint 2010,并且经常希望看到他们的产品,例如实现用户安全性的桌面访问数据库" - 在SharePoint上。我们经常使用PowerPoint来满足这种需求,但它不那么强大并且需要大量的手动干预,而且由于我构建的许多前端接口都具有复杂的表单验证以及全面的报表视图,因此它似乎离开了需要考虑很多。

我在2005年至2009年期间只与Visual Studio合作,我知道很多都已经改变了。我知道SharePoint也在广泛发展。

我也听说过InfoPath,但是如果我想要真正的控制,尤其是数据输入,请阅读我需要Visual Studio。我还考虑过MS Access中的Web App组件,但在这方面有许多安全限制,我从未考虑过这些限制。如果我无法访问Visual Studio或VBA以外的任何其他内容,那么我在VBA中可以使用SharePoint 2010和桌面MS Access的所有选项有哪些选择?

1 个答案:

答案 0 :(得分:0)

您有两种选择:

1)您可以使用Microsoft Access创建数据库,并使用Access Services

将其发布到Microsoft SharePoint 2010

2)您可以创建Sharepoint列表并在Microsoft Access中链接它们并像表一样使用它们并在Microsoft Access中使用VBA